@kamino-finance/farms-sdk
Version:
30 lines • 1.14 kB
JavaScript
;
/**
* This code was AUTOGENERATED using the Codama library.
* Please DO NOT EDIT THIS FILE, instead use visitors
* to add features, then rerun Codama to update it.
*
* @see https://github.com/codama-idl/codama
*/
Object.defineProperty(exports, "__esModule", { value: true });
exports.LockingMode = void 0;
exports.getLockingModeEncoder = getLockingModeEncoder;
exports.getLockingModeDecoder = getLockingModeDecoder;
exports.getLockingModeCodec = getLockingModeCodec;
const kit_1 = require("@solana/kit");
var LockingMode;
(function (LockingMode) {
LockingMode[LockingMode["None"] = 0] = "None";
LockingMode[LockingMode["Continuous"] = 1] = "Continuous";
LockingMode[LockingMode["WithExpiry"] = 2] = "WithExpiry";
})(LockingMode || (exports.LockingMode = LockingMode = {}));
function getLockingModeEncoder() {
return (0, kit_1.getEnumEncoder)(LockingMode);
}
function getLockingModeDecoder() {
return (0, kit_1.getEnumDecoder)(LockingMode);
}
function getLockingModeCodec() {
return (0, kit_1.combineCodec)(getLockingModeEncoder(), getLockingModeDecoder());
}
//# sourceMappingURL=lockingMode.js.map